The mod creator says they’ve dedicated 2,000 hours over the last two years to make Runelite HD but was only recently messaged by Jagex.

Runescape developer Jagex has put an end to Runelite HD, a fan-made HD mod of the popular open-source client for Old School Runescape, just as the project was about to launch last Monday. The 11th-hour move has some Runescape fans decrying Jagex’s decision and saying they’ll move to other MMOs.
